This three-bedroom, freehold terraced house in Lexden offers practical family living with good transport links. The ground floor has a modern fitted kitchen, convenient shower room and a lounge opening into a conservatory that leads to a large rear garden — useful for children and outdoor storage.
Upstairs are three good-sized bedrooms and a family bathroom. The property measures approximately 914 sq ft and benefits from fast broadband, making it suitable for home working or study. Colchester North Station, the city centre and good local schools are within easy reach, adding daily convenience.
Practical considerations are straightforward: parking is on-street only and the neighbourhood scores as a more deprived area with average crime statistics. The home is mid-20th century with standard ceiling heights and appears well maintained, but buyers should view to assess any modernisation or maintenance they may want to undertake.
Overall this house presents a sensible purchase for a family seeking space, transport links and a large garden, or for an investor targeting steady rental demand close to schools and rail connections.
